Installation Guide
-
Safety First: Disconnect the vessel's battery and close the raw water intake seacock.
-
Access the Pump: Locate the sea water pump on the engine block.
-
Disconnect Hoses: Loosen the hose clamps and carefully detach the intake and outlet hoses from the pump.
-
Remove Old Pump: Unfasten the mounting bolts securing the pump to the engine. Gently remove the old pump assembly.
-
Prepare Surface: Clean the engine mounting surface and inspect it for any damage or old gasket material.
-
Install New Pump: Position the new sea water pump, ensuring it aligns correctly with the mounting holes.
-
Secure Pump: Hand-tighten the mounting bolts first, then torque them to the manufacturer's recommended specification.
-
Reconnect Hoses: Attach the raw water hoses to the new pump and secure them firmly with the hose clamps.
-
Final Checks: Open the raw water seacock and reconnect the battery.
-
Test for Leaks: Start the engine and immediately check the pump and hose connections for any signs of water leaks. Confirm water is exiting the exhaust.

Q: What are the symptoms of a failing sea water pump?
A: Common signs include the engine overheating, a noticeable reduction in water flow from the exhaust, or visible water leaks around the pump housing or weep holes. A damaged impeller is a frequent cause of failure.
Q: How often should the impeller be replaced?
A: The included impeller (653-0001) should be inspected at least once a year and replaced every 1-2 years as part of regular maintenance, or as recommended in your Yanmar service manual. Operating in sandy or debris-heavy water may require more frequent changes.
